nginx 使用https 需要安装哪些必须的依赖
时间: 2024-01-08 11:03:51 浏览: 66
在Nginx上启用HTTPS时,您需要确保安装了以下必要的依赖:
1. OpenSSL:Nginx使用OpenSSL库来进行SSL/TLS加密和解密操作。您需要安装OpenSSL库及其开发包。
2. PCRE:PCRE(Perl Compatible Regular Expressions)是一个用于处理正则表达式的库。Nginx使用PCRE来进行URL重写和其他模式匹配操作。确保安装了PCRE库及其开发包。
3. zlib:zlib是一个用于数据压缩和解压缩的库。Nginx使用zlib来对传输的数据进行压缩。确保安装了zlib库及其开发包。
4. ngx_http_ssl_module:这是Nginx的一个模块,用于支持SSL/TLS协议。在编译Nginx时,需要启用此模块。
这些依赖通常可以通过包管理器来安装,具体安装命令会因您使用的操作系统和包管理器而有所不同。请注意,这些是常见的依赖,实际上可能还有其他依赖因您使用的特定功能而有所不同。
在编译和安装Nginx之前,确保您已正确安装了所有必要的依赖,并且它们处于最新版本。在Nginx官方文档中可以找到更详细的编译和安装指南,以确保正确配置所需的依赖项。
相关问题
Ubuntu系统编译安装nginx需要哪些依赖
Ubuntu系统编译安装nginx需要以下依赖:
- gcc编译器
- make工具
- zlib库
- PCRE库
- OpenSSL库
你可以使用以下命令安装这些依赖:
sudo apt-get install build-essential zlib1g-dev libpcre3-dev libssl-dev
阅读全文